Ordinals
beta
Sat 844142372875658
decimal
168828.2372875658
degree
0°168828′1500″2372875658‴
percentile
40.19725589543881%
name
hwgvlfpezmd
cycle
0
epoch
0
period
83
block
168828
offset
2372875658
timestamp
2012-02-28 04:28:47 UTC
rarity
common
prev
next